INTERRA Group Increases Occupancy Rate in Shopping Centre Portfolio to 89 Percent

The INTERRA Group has seen a significant increase in the occupancy rate of its seven shopping centres since the beginning of the year, rising from 74 to 89 percent of the total rental area.

The INTERRA Group has substantially improved the occupancy rate of its portfolio of seven shopping centres since the beginning of the year. The total rental area comprises approximately 185,950 square metres. At the start of the year, 74 percent of this was let; the current figure stands at about 165,500 square metres, corresponding to an occupancy rate of 89 percent. In the first seven months of the current year, approximately 27,500 square metres were newly let and restructured. Of this, over 10,000 square metres were accounted for in the first quarter, over 12,000 square metres in the second quarter, and so far 5,500 square metres in the third quarter, for which INTERRA is aiming for a target of 15,000 square metres. Currently, about 20,000 square metres are still available.

Property management, facility management, and marketing are deliberately handled in-house. This strategy allows for early anticipation of developments such as a tenant default, rather than having to react only on the day of a termination, as Alexander Dold explained.

At the Handelscentrum Strausberg, the largest single deal in recent months was concluded with the establishment of New Yorker. For this purpose, INTERRA is constructing a targeted new building, as the brand was requested by both the town and visitors. Simultaneously, local amenities were strengthened: Netto Marken-Discount opened its branch on 21 April 2026. Takko is also new to the site. Rossmann will move from an interim location to the former C&A space, with the reopening planned for the fourth quarter of 2026. The centre features over 60 shops and approximately 1,300 free parking spaces.

The Leine-Center Laatzen has been continuously developed since its acquisition in 2025, with a focus on the tenant mix, technology, and visitor experience. Recent additions include Takko Fashion with approximately 600 square metres, the cosmetics brand Rituals, the bakery Steinecke, and the textile provider KEF, who is returning after a previous presence. Rossmann has extended its lease long-term. A special feature is the signing of the lease agreement with the City of Laatzen for a citizen's office and a city library on 7 August 2026. The city library will occupy approximately 890 square metres in the former Kult space, and the citizen's office 453 square metres in a former Reno branch. Both units, which together form approximately 1,343 square metres of public space within the shopping centre, are barrier-free. The lease commencement is flexibly planned for the first half of 2027, with the aim of moving in by February or March. An architectural firm is developing the spatial concepts. Alexander Dold emphasised that the citizen's office and city library will serve as regular points of contact for many people in Laatzen. In addition, technical and energy modernisations are planned, including the renewal of building services, the implementation of smart building solutions, improved energy efficiency, additional charging infrastructure, and prospectively, photovoltaics.

At Palais Vest Recklinghausen, the largest single measure is nearing completion: Müller is taking over 2,200 square metres in a central location. The opening is scheduled for early December. The conversion involved the precise adjustment of ceiling and floor slabs, the preparation of shafts, and the installation of new escalators by HEGERATH. Additionally, the ice cream parlour La Luna has extended its lease by ten years and will also be refurbished. Palais Vest offers approximately 45,600 square metres of rental space, about 100 units, and 970 parking spaces. The annual 7.6 million visitors and the DGNB Platinum certification underscore the relevance of the location. Furthermore, a public drinking fountain was opened at the centre in cooperation with the City of Recklinghausen and Gelsenwasser.

Shopping Plaza Garbsen is approaching full occupancy. New leases were signed with ONLY for 314 square metres and with the shoe provider Tamaris. The occupancy rate at the time of acquisition was 92 percent across 20,654 square metres of rental space with a WAULT of 4.6 years. Currently, only four spaces remain to achieve full occupancy, which INTERRA aims to reach in its anniversary year.

INTERRA pursues a strategy of active asset management that goes beyond mere property administration. Vacancies are analysed, spaces are reconfigured, and usage concepts are supplemented by retail, services, municipal offerings, and gastronomy. The overarching goal is to develop existing properties into long-term stable, economically successful, and relevant locations for their respective cities.
